Output e65f6ef8ecc43b74e2616d87d07df93069e8d52c34cac8b0f4e12936dab58311:22

value
619000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26a708e4958084637549ce9edd08e10a2a6d388a OP_EQUAL
address
35DPhcMWoojtaijAc7J4L2yawzUuLHKWzP
transaction
e65f6ef8ecc43b74e2616d87d07df93069e8d52c34cac8b0f4e12936dab58311